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/mpc-hc/mpc-hc.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orCasimir666 <casimir666@users.sourceforge.net>2008-05-24 14:09:25 +0400
committerCasimir666 <casimir666@users.sourceforge.net>2008-05-24 14:09:25 +0400
commit5d74fbc888daeb3de48063050ad794875a9c4211 (patch)
tree5249b4cc78905827a71353f50192f0ae1faa11c6 /src/filters/transform/mpcvideodec/DXVADecoder.h
parent1851fd89dfdb21efb5c2e3dff5b1285075e53a28 (diff)
Random crash with EVR custom, memory leak DXVA, crash on DXVA when playing video twice, cleanup on shader resources
git-svn-id: https://mpc-hc.svn.sourceforge.net/svnroot/mpc-hc/trunk@521 10f7b99b-c216-0410-bff0-8a66a9350fd8
Diffstat (limited to 'src/filters/transform/mpcvideodec/DXVADecoder.h')
-rw-r--r--src/filters/transform/mpcvideodec/DXVADecoder.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/filters/transform/mpcvideodec/DXVADecoder.h b/src/filters/transform/mpcvideodec/DXVADecoder.h
index a8a255ffa..b40362732 100644
--- a/src/filters/transform/mpcvideodec/DXVADecoder.h
+++ b/src/filters/transform/mpcvideodec/DXVADecoder.h
@@ -61,6 +61,7 @@ public :
DXVAMode GetMode() { return m_nMode; };
DXVA_ENGINE GetEngine() { return m_nEngine; };
void AllocExecuteParams (int nSize);
+ void SetDirectXVideoDec (IDirectXVideoDecoder* pDirectXVideoDec) { m_pDirectXVideoDec = pDirectXVideoDec; };
virtual HRESULT DecodeFrame (BYTE* pDataIn, UINT nSize, REFERENCE_TIME rtStart, REFERENCE_TIME rtStop) = NULL;
virtual void SetExtraData (BYTE* pDataIn, UINT nSize);